About Intertext
intertext is synonymous with maximum quality according to translation sector standards at highly competitive prices. our translation company, based in barcelona, has been offering pr... Read more
intertext is synonymous with maximum quality according to translation sector standards at highly competitive prices. our translation company, based in barcelona, has been offering pr... Read more
Looking for contact data? Unlock accurate emails and phone numbers for your ideal prospects with Tomba.